JIS Machino Coupling

The FUXEON® JIS Machino Coupling is a quick-connect component designed for connecting fire hoses, fire trucks, landing valves, fire hydrants, and nozzles. It uses an internal slider and slot-locking structure to provide a fast connection without the multiple rotations required by conventional threaded interfaces.

The JIS Machino Coupling is commonly supplied in DN40, DN50, and DN65 sizes, with additional sizes available according to project requirements. Its push-type connection allows operators to connect and disconnect hoses quickly, which is particularly useful during firefighting operations where connection time is critical.

Connection Structure

Locking Mechanism

The machino fire hose coupling uses an internal spring to push a slider into the mating slot after the male and female components are connected. This mechanical locking structure secures the joint during operation, while a rubber sealing ring provides sealing between the connected components.

To disconnect the coupling, the ring mechanism on the male side is pressed to retract the internal slider. The connection can then be separated without rotating a threaded interface.

Connection Speed

Compared with threaded connectors, the push-type design reduces the number of manual operations required during connection and disconnection. The operator inserts the male end into the matching female connection until the locking mechanism engages.

The multi-stage anti-slip structure helps maintain proper engagement during connection and unlocking. The operating method is straightforward and does not require specialized training for routine use.

Material Selection

Material Comparison

FUXEON® JIS Machino Coupling is available in brass, aluminum, and stainless steel. Material selection affects connector weight, mechanical strength, corrosion resistance, service environment, and procurement cost. The following values are typical reference ranges, while actual properties depend on the selected alloy, material grade, heat treatment, and manufacturing process.

Material Selection

Brass is suitable for conventional firefighting applications where mechanical strength, corrosion resistance, machinability, and connection durability need to be balanced. Aluminum alloy is preferred when reducing the weight of portable firefighting equipment is important. Stainless steel is more suitable for applications requiring higher corrosion resistance and mechanical strength.

Final material selection should consider working pressure, water or foam mixture, environmental corrosion, equipment weight, expected service conditions, and the specific material grade.

Applications

Firefighting Systems

The JIS Machino Coupling can connect fire hoses with compatible fire hydrants, landing valves, fire trucks, and nozzles. Its quick connection structure is suitable for firefighting systems where hoses need to be connected or replaced efficiently.

Other Uses

The coupling can also be used in agricultural irrigation, construction sites, and marine safety applications where compatible hose connections and rapid manual operation are required.

The actual application should be based on working pressure, medium, connection dimensions, material, and applicable standards.

FAQ

What Is a Machino Coupling?

A Machino coupling is a quick-connect hose connector commonly used in firefighting and other fluid-transfer applications. It uses a mechanical locking structure instead of relying solely on a threaded connection.

How Does It Connect?

The male end is inserted into the matching female connection, allowing the internal spring-loaded slider to engage with the slot. The rubber sealing ring then provides sealing at the joint.

How Is It Disconnected?

The ring mechanism on the male side is pressed to release the internal slider, after which the two connection components can be separated.

What Sizes Are Available?

Common nominal sizes include DN40, DN50, and DN65. The listed product range includes 1 1/2", 2", 2.5", and 3", with other sizes available on request.
